Sr Principal Software Engineer

At Northrop Grumman Aerospace Systems we develop cutting-edge technology that preserves freedom and advances human discovery. Our pioneering and inventive spirit has enabled us to be at the forefront of many technological advancements in our nation's history - from the first flight across the Atlantic Ocean, to stealth bombers, to landing on the moon. We continue to innovate with developments from launching the first commercial flight to space, to discovering the early beginnings of the universe. Our employees are not only part of history, they're making history.

Looking for an embedded flight software candidate with experience developing device drivers.Candidate will be working alongside other embedded software engineers and hardware engineers to support HW/SW integration. Willbe on the front end of supporting software and driver updates to support hardware modification to existing units.

Preferred skills include C programming, WindRiver VxWorks, PowerPC, and Green Hills Tools.
Basic Qualifications:

  • Bachelor's Degree in a Science, Technology, Engineering or Mathematics (STEM) discipline from an accredited university and 9 years of software engineering experience OR Master's Degree in STEM and 7 years of software engineering experience OR PhD Degree in STEM and 4 years of software engineering experience
  • Experience developing Device Drivers
  • Hands-on embedded experience

Preferred Qualifications:
  • WindRiver VxWorks
  • Active in-scope DoD Clearance and SCI Clearance

Northrop Grumman is committed to hiring and retaining a diverse workforce. We are proud to be an Equal Opportunity/Affirmative Action Employer, making decisions without regard to race, color, religion, creed, sex, sexual orientation, gender identity, marital status, national origin, age, veteran status, disability, or any other protected class. For our complete EEO/AA and Pay Transparency statement, please visit . U.S. Citizenship is required for most positions.

Back to top